Charles County Project Linus
Volunteers are needed to make kid-friendly blankets/quilts/afghans to be donated to sick, traumatized, injured children, age Infant through 18 years, in the Charles County, MD., and surrounding areas. Meetings are held monthly to tag, label, count and bag the blankets, and attendance is totally voluntary. Blankets can be made at home and left in various collection boxes throughout Charles County, or you could join others to work on blankets at the local senior center once a week on Friday mornings.
* Great for: Seniors, home school groups, girl scout troops, and anyone who can crochet, knit, sew, quilt, cut with scissors or tie a knot!
Project Linus is a National organization with a website at www.ProjectLinus.org There are over 300 chapters throughout th US, and other chapters can be found at the National Site.
